Situated in the Industrial District of Downtown Los Angeles, Los Angeles Farmers serves as the flagship retail location for the renowned Jungle Boys brand. This facility has established a reputation rooted in local cultivation history, offering a direct-from-the-source experience for enthusiasts seeking authentic, locally grown genetics. The spacious, modern showroom features clean aesthetic lines and clear displays that highlight a diverse selection of flowers, concentrates, and extracts produced right here in Southern California.

Positioned near the intersection of the Santa Monica Freeway and Interstate 5, the location provides convenient access for both downtown residents and those commuting through the metro area. Secure on-site parking and an efficient check-in process help streamline the visit, making it a reliable stop for patrons looking to explore curated, small-batch harvests. The storefront operates daily, maintaining a focus on transparency and compliance within the regulated California market.

Visited Original Farmers Market next to The Grove, and this place is a must-visit if you love food. It’s not just a market — it’s a food paradise with tons of different options. From classic American food to Mexican, BBQ, seafood, desserts, and even international cuisines, there’s something for everyone. What makes this place special is the atmosphere. It has a slightly old-school, historic vibe, but still feels lively and modern at the same time. You can just walk around, try different foods, and enjoy the energy. The portions are generous, and most of the food I tried was solid. It’s a great spot to come with a group so you can try a variety of dishes. Seating can be limited during busy hours, and it can get pretty crowded, especially on weekends. But that’s part of the experience here. Overall, this is one of the best places in LA to casually eat, explore, and experience local food culture. Check my profile for travel tips and hidden deals.

If you’re looking for a fun and bustling spot in Los Angeles, the Original Farmers Market is definitely worth a visit. My husband and I had a great time exploring all the different shops, stalls, and eateries. There’s so much to see! We spent a lot of time in the main area and didn’t realize how much more there was to explore in the surrounding area. We were short on time, otherwise we would have loved to wander around even more. There’s a wide variety of food available, from fresh seafood to international cuisine, sweets, and everything in between. There’s something to satisfy every craving. It can get busy with a lot of foot traffic, but there are plenty of areas with seating to take a break and enjoy the atmosphere. Just a heads-up: it’s easy to get turned around in here because there’s so much to explore, but that’s part of the fun. One nice bonus is that a lot of space inside the market is covered, so even if the weather isn’t great, you won’t need to worry about rain or intense sun interfering with your visit. Overall, we had a fantastic time sampling the food and soaking in the lively vibes. It’s a great spot for couples, families, or anyone who loves a classic LA experience!
